Cómo crear un sitio web multilingüe en WordPress
Publicado: 2024-01-30La mayoría de nosotros sabemos que los complementos son la respuesta a la pregunta de cómo crear un sitio web multilingüe en WordPress. Sin embargo, esto es sólo una pequeña parte de la historia. El diseño de sitios web multilingües en la web puede ser complejo e incorporar una serie de tecnologías y estrategias avanzadas que debe comprender en su totalidad. Si bien la optimización de motores de búsqueda (SEO) es importante, también necesitará comprender la cultura de cada lugar para generar confianza y lealtad hacia su sitio.
En esta publicación, aprenderá cómo crear un sitio web multilingüe en WordPress utilizando uno de los complementos más populares, junto con algunos otros detalles importantes para que su sitio web multilingüe sea un éxito.
📚 Aquí está el desglose completo de lo que cubrirá el artículo:
- Por qué un sitio web multilingüe es una necesidad
- El contexto cultural que hay que entender al traducir contenidos
- Ayuda con tu estrategia SEO multiidioma
- Los complementos disponibles para ayudarlo a crear un sitio web multilingüe con WordPress
- Cómo crear un sitio web multilingüe en WordPress usando el complemento Polylang
Comprender la necesidad de un sitio web multilingüe
Internet es una plataforma fundamental para la comunicación, el comercio y el intercambio de ideas. Como tal, un sitio web multilingüe es crucial para cualquier sitio que pretenda llegar a una audiencia global más amplia.
👉 De hecho, hay tres razones clave por las que un sitio web multilingüe debería ser una prioridad:
- Muestra sensibilidad cultural y respeto por sus usuarios . Un sitio web que está disponible en muchos idiomas reconoce la diversidad de su audiencia. Esto ofrecerá un importante impulso a la UX y hará que los visitantes se sientan valorados y comprendidos. También puede fomentar una sensación de conexión y confianza entre usted y sus usuarios. Esto es importante en mercados donde el inglés es un segundo idioma.
- Un sitio web multilingüe ampliará su alcance en el mercado . Internet es global, pero no todo el mundo habla o prefiere navegar en inglés. Si ofrece contenido en varios idiomas, puede acceder a nuevos mercados y datos demográficos. Esto aumentará su base de clientes potenciales y también proporcionará una ventaja competitiva.
- Puedes mejorar tu SEO . Los motores de búsqueda se centran en la UX y parte de eso implica la redirección al contenido en un idioma preferido. El contenido multilingüe ayuda a mejorar su clasificación de búsqueda para diferentes países e idiomas. A su vez, esto puede atraer más tráfico orgánico.
- Los sitios web multilingües pueden generar una mayor participación . Con la opción de seleccionar un idioma principal, será más probable que los usuarios permanezcan más tiempo en el sitio. Es más, verá una participación más profunda y una mayor cantidad de conversiones.
En resumen, un sitio web multilingüe no es sólo una característica adicional; es una necesidad si tienes una audiencia multilingüe.
Sin embargo, es necesario acertar con esa estrategia. 🧩 En la siguiente sección, cubriremos esto con mayor detalle.
Matices culturales en la traducción de contenidos
Otra parte importante de cómo crear un sitio web multilingüe en WordPress es la localización del sitio web.
Comprender la diversidad cultural cuando se trata de contenido multilingüe es clave para su éxito. Traducir contenidos no se trata sólo de cambiar palabras de un idioma a otro. En cambio, debe transmitir el mismo mensaje, tono e intención adecuados para su usuario objetivo. Este es un trabajo de 'localización'.
Aquí es donde adapta el contenido para que se adapte a las normas culturales, sociales y legales de sus usuarios. Como tal, hay que pensar no sólo en la precisión del lenguaje sino también en la relevancia cultural.
Por ejemplo, debe considerar expresiones naturales, humor, costumbres y creencias locales para evitar molestar a sus usuarios. Es más, debe comprender la sensibilidad cultural y adaptar sus sitios para evitar alienar a su base de usuarios.
En pocas palabras, la localización tiene que ver con mejorar la UX y el compromiso. El contenido que refleja su comprensión de la cultura local genera confianza y credibilidad. Esta "alineación cultural" puede hacer que sus usuarios se sientan vistos y comprendidos. A su vez, esto aumentará su conexión con su marca.
Estrategias SEO para sitios web multilingües
Aprender a crear un sitio web multilingüe en WordPress siempre implicará SEO, ya que esto aumenta la visibilidad global. Hay muchos aspectos diferentes en esto, como ocurre con el SEO normal. La velocidad del sitio es una constante, al igual que la creación de vínculos de retroceso y la señalización social.
Sin embargo, hay que tener en cuenta algunos detalles específicos de una estrategia multilingüe. Veámoslos brevemente.
La estructura de tu sitio web 🚧
Por ejemplo, tome la estructura de su URL. Hay dos aspectos de esto. En primer lugar, sus sitios en idiomas específicos podrían utilizar un dominio de nivel superior (ccTLD) codificado por país. Aquí es donde cada sitio utiliza una variante local de un TLD, como .fr o .ca :
Para un sitio de dominio único, utilizará subdominios o subdirectorios:
- Subdominios . Navegará a sitios utilizando un código de país al "frente" del dominio, como fr.example.com
- Subdirectorios . Aquí, los archivos del sitio se encuentran en un directorio específico al que navegará, como ejemplo.com/fr
Estos ayudan a organizar versiones en diferentes idiomas bajo el mismo dominio. Los motores de búsqueda también disfrutarán de una organización clara, ya que la indexación será mejor.
Estrategias de optimización de palabras clave y traducción de contenidos 💡
Como ocurre con cualquier estrategia de SEO, la optimización de las palabras clave locales es crucial. Sin embargo, aquí es importante investigar y elegir palabras clave según los comportamientos de búsqueda en el idioma de destino. Traducir palabras clave en inglés carecerá de comprensión de los contextos culturales.
Hablando de eso, el contenido de calidad con relevancia cultural es la piedra angular del SEO. Hay muchas formas de traducir contenido y cada una tiene sus pros y sus contras:
- Autotraducción . Si habla un segundo idioma, puede traducir su sitio. Aunque esto afectará más a tu tiempo.
- Máquina traductora . Algunos modelos de lenguaje, como DeepL y Google Translator, pueden hacer un trabajo admirable. El inconveniente es la precisión de la traducción, especialmente cuando se trata de crear una sensación "natural".
- Traducción profesional . Contratar a un experto para traducir su contenido le brindará el más alto nivel de precisión. Por otro lado, cuesta y el flujo de trabajo tardará más en completarse.
Además, este debería ser el caso de todo su contenido, como el cuerpo del texto, las meta descripciones, el texto alternativo y las páginas de archivo.
Sin embargo, hay un aspecto en el que vale la pena centrarse más que en el resto: las etiquetas hreflang
.
Implementando etiquetas hreflang ☑️
Cuando se trata de SEO multilingüe, las etiquetas ' hreflang
' representan su 'jefe final'. La mayoría de los sitios tienen problemas cuando se trata de etiquetas hreflang
. Es más, Google lo recomienda, pero John Mueller señala que es el "aspecto más complejo del SEO". Si un defensor de la búsqueda de Google dice esto, vale la pena tomarse el tiempo para estudiar las etiquetas hreflang
en su totalidad.
Son etiquetas HTML que utilizan atributos para indicar a los motores de búsqueda dónde enviar a los visitantes. Por ejemplo, si un usuario alemán visita su sitio, la etiqueta hreflang
debería redirigirlo a la versión local correcta. A primera vista, la etiqueta parece sencilla:
<link rel="alternate" href="http://example.com/de" hreflang="de-de" />
Usted define la relación entre su sitio principal y el de idioma secundario (es decir, 'alternate'
). A partir de ahí, enumera la URL de destino en cuestión y finaliza con una etiqueta hreflang
adecuada.
Esta etiqueta muestra el idioma de la URL y luego el país de la URL. Para nuestro ejemplo alemán, ambos son de
. Sin embargo, considere un canadiense francés. En este caso, la etiqueta hreflang
sería fr-ca
, el idioma francés en Canadá.
Implementarlos de forma manual requiere mucho trabajo, aunque las herramientas en línea pueden ayudar:
De hecho, esto es mucho trabajo para un sitio web multilingüe en WordPress. Como tal, usar un complemento es el mejor enfoque a seguir y lo cubriremos a continuación.
Los mejores complementos de sitios web multilingües de WordPress
Cuando se trata de cómo crear un sitio web multilingüe en WordPress, la mejor opción es utilizar un complemento de traducción dedicado. Esto se debe a que la funcionalidad ya está implementada y gran parte del trabajo duro ya está completo.
Es más, hay muchos complementos que te ayudarán a traducir un sitio web. WPML (desde 39 € al año) es uno de los complementos premium más populares disponibles:
Esto se debe a su rico conjunto de funciones. Puede trabajar en traducciones dentro del editor de WordPress, ejecutar su contenido a través de herramientas de traducción automática e integrar servicios de traducción profesionales. Además, WPML admite varios creadores de páginas, junto con sitios de comercio electrónico.
Polylang ofrece versiones gratuitas y premium (desde 99 € al año). Diríamos que este es uno de los complementos más integrados con WordPress.
Por ejemplo, ofrece compatibilidad con Yoast SEO y se integra con el editor de sitios nativo de WordPress. Es más, te permite traducir todo el contenido de WordPress, incluidos menús, medios, tipos de publicaciones personalizadas y widgets. También obtienes una implementación automática de etiquetas hreflang
, lo que te ahorrará un tiempo considerable.
TranslatePress también ofrece su funcionalidad principal en un complemento gratuito y vende complementos premium desde 7,99 € al mes. Un gran punto de venta aquí es su integración con Google Translate, que le permite convertir su contenido utilizando una de las mejores herramientas de traducción automática del mercado.
También ofrece un editor de traducción visual que es único entre las otras herramientas de esta lista.
Con los planes premium, también puedes ampliar esta traducción automática a DeepL. Sin embargo, el complemento gratuito solo le permite traducir su sitio a un idioma nuevo. Si desea ofrecer tres o más idiomas, deberá actualizar a la versión premium.
Cómo crear un sitio web multilingüe en WordPress usando Polylang (en 3 pasos)
Antes de concluir la publicación, le mostraremos cómo usar Polylang para crear un sitio web multilingüe con WordPress. Si bien elegimos solo una solución para mostrar aquí, el proceso básico será similar en otros complementos de traducción.
De todos modos, una vez que instales y actives el complemento, podrás comenzar a traducir tu contenido. Cuando ejecute el complemento por primera vez, el asistente de Polylang será la mejor manera de agregar idiomas. Veamos esto primero.
1. Ejecute el asistente de incorporación de Polylang 🧙♂️
La primera pantalla le pide que enumere todos los idiomas que usará en su sitio usando el menú desplegable:
La siguiente pantalla le pregunta si desea traducir metadatos multimedia (como texto alternativo y subtítulos). Recomendamos esto:
También deberá asignar un idioma relevante a cualquier publicación, página o taxonomía sin contenido. La penúltima pantalla confirma su página de inicio y le brinda información sobre el próximo proceso de traducción:
La pantalla final del asistente le indica algunos de los siguientes pasos a seguir, como traducir la navegación y las páginas. Traducir su contenido debería ser su próximo paso.
2. Comienza a traducir tu contenido 🏁
Para traducir su contenido, diríjase a una publicación o página, luego mire la barra lateral del editor o las opciones. Aquí verás la barra lateral de Idiomas :
El menú desplegable Idioma especifica el idioma actual de su página. Si hace clic en una de las opciones en la sección Traducción, la página se actualizará para mostrar una pantalla de edición vacía. Aquí es donde colocarás tu contenido traducido:
Para finalizar, publique la página y compruébela en la parte frontal. Hay un paso más antes de terminar: brindar a los usuarios una forma de elegir su idioma en la interfaz.
3. Agregue el selector de idiomas Polylang a su interfaz 🕹️
Hay muchas formas en que Polylang le permite agregar un menú a su sitio para cambiar el idioma. Para crear una experiencia consistente, puede agregar idiomas casi en cualquier lugar de su sitio.
Por ejemplo, la documentación de Polylang le ofrece varias opciones de navegación, bloques y más. Esto debería ser sencillo, ya que solo agrega elementos a su estructura como es típico.
Tenga en cuenta que también existe un método PHP con todas las funciones para implementar un conmutador de idiomas. Está limpio, ya que usa una línea:
pll_the_languages( $args );
Aquí, $args
es un parámetro opcional que requiere muchas opciones. Por ejemplo, puede optar por mostrar el conmutador como un menú desplegable, mostrar banderas y más.
Conclusión 🧐
Con esto concluye nuestra guía sobre cómo crear un sitio web multilingüe en WordPress.
Dado lo conectado que está el mundo, debes asegurarte de que cada usuario que visite tu sitio pueda interactuar con él de la misma manera.
Crear un sitio web multilingüe es sólo una pieza del rompecabezas. Sin embargo, si hace esto bien, podrá abrir nuevos mercados, aprovechar la lealtad y la confianza y ofrecer sus ofertas en todo el mundo.
Polylang puede ser una excelente forma gratuita de lograrlo, ya que puede traducir su contenido dentro de WordPress con solo unos clics. Sin embargo, hay muchas otras soluciones de calidad si está dispuesto a pagar, como WPML y TranslatePress ( que en realidad es gratuito si solo necesita agregar un nuevo idioma ). 🔌
¿Tiene alguna pregunta sobre cómo crear un sitio web multilingüe en WordPress? ¡Pregunta en la sección de comentarios a continuación!